Built Tough: Gorilla Armor 2, Titanium Frame, and IP68 Confidence

This front glass uses Gorilla Armor 2 protection, scratches ka risk kam hota hai, and the anti reflective behavior is designed to improve clarity in bright environments. Corning describes Gorilla Armor 2 as a scratch resistant, anti reflective glass ceramic for the Galaxy S25 Ultra, and it also reports lab results like surviving drops up to 2.2 meters on a concrete replicating surface. Samsung also announces this Gorilla Armor 2 integration for the S25 Ultra, which supports the idea that durability is engineered into the flagship rather than left to third party cases. This chassis also includes a titanium frame, grip secure rehta hai, helping the phone feel rigid when you use it one handed. Samsung’s comparison content lists IP68 water and dust resistance and notes a 1.5m/30min condition, so occasional water exposure is a supported scenario rather than a gamble. PTA Approved Variant: Ready for Pakistani Networks With Peace of Mind

This PTA Approved status matters for Pakistan use, local SIM chalane mein masla nahi hota, because PTA’s DIRBS system is designed to allow only registered/standardized IMEIs on Pakistani mobile networks after the policy’s enforcement timeline. Government linked guidance on DIRBS explains that devices intended for use on Pakistan mobile networks may require IMEI registration via the DIRBS portal, which is the practical meaning buyers usually want when they ask for “PTA approved”. This reassurance is valuable for travelers and overseas buyers, Pakistan visit par connectivity tension kam, since compliant devices are meant to remain operational on local networks under the DIRBS framework.
